Top Lightweight Rain Jackets for Hiking and Backpacking: A Comprehensive Guide
When choosing a lightweight rain jacket for hiking and backpacking, several key factors such as breathability, waterproofing, packability, and durability must be considered. This guide will help you identify the top options based on these criteria, ensuring you stay comfortable and protected in all weather conditions.
Top Recommendations
1. Patagonia Torrentshell 3L
Weight: ~13 oz (370 g)
Features: Equipped with 3-layer H2No Performance Standard waterproof/breathable technology, adjustable hood, and pit zips for ventilation.
Packability: Can be packed into its own pocket, making it easy to carry and store during hikes.
2. Arcteryx Beta SL Hybrid Jacket
Weight: ~10 oz (280 g)
Features: Gore-Tex fabric provides excellent waterproofing, lightweight, and durability. Includes a helmet-compatible hood.
Packability: Can be packed down small for easy storage in a backpack.
3. The North Face Venture 2 Jacket
Weight: ~11 oz (312 g)
Features: DryVent 2.5L fabric for waterproofing and breathability, adjustable hood and hem.
Packability: Packs into its own pocket for convenient carrying.
4. Outdoor Research Helium II Jacket
Weight: ~6.4 oz (181 g)
Features: Waterproof and highly compressible jacket with an adjustable hood and elastic cuffs.
Packability: Extremely packable, fits easily into a pocket.
5. Marmot PreCip Eco Jacket
Weight: ~10 oz (283 g)
Features: NanoPro waterproof/breathable fabric, pit zips for ventilation, and an adjustable hood.
Packability: Packs into its own pocket or a small bag.
Considerations for Choosing the Right Jacket
Fit: Make sure the jacket allows for layering underneath without being too tight. A properly fitting jacket will enhance comfort and functionality.
Ventilation: Look for features like pit zips or mesh lining, which can help regulate temperature during physical activity. Effective ventilation allows for breathability and prevents overheating, especially during strenuous hikes.
Durability: Consider how rugged the fabric is, especially if you plan to hike in rough terrain. The durability of the fabric can significantly affect the performance and longevity of the jacket.
Ultimately, the best choice will depend on your specific needs, preferences, and budget. It's a good idea to try on different jackets if possible to find the best fit and comfort for your hiking style.
